    Could not have nicer things to say about working with My Chef and Jamie Walsh for our wedding day…read morecatering. We met Jamie at our venue's vendor expo and were immediately impressed by their services, pricing, and vast food offerings. It was a no brainer to book with their group! We had our tasting a couple months before our wedding day; which is complimentary to the couple and a $50 charge for any additional guest to join. They have you select 8-10 appetizers, 2 salads, and 4 entrees to taste at their Naperville location. They also have displays of china, silverware, glasses and more to help couples select what aligns aesthetically for their special day. Jamie worked with us to make small modifications to their standard offerings to make the food exactly what we wanted! Our wedding day came and we were floored by the quality/presentation of food, level of detail in place settings, and service from all staff members. We had multiple guests say that this was some of the best wedding food they've had, steaks were not over cooked, and food tasted fresh. Jamie also let us add desserts a week out to reallocate money from a couple of guests who last minute were unable to attend. Their team was even nice enough to service items not purchased through their group: disposables for the late night snack, display and refilling of cupcakes, etc. Overall, their group went above and beyond for us under Jamie's leadership. Our tables looked great, our food was wonderful, and their team was fabulous. We truly appreciate all they've done for us and could not recommend them more! Appetizers Selected: Mac & Cheese Bites, Bacon Wrapped Dates w Honey Citrus Sauce, Cocktail Meatballs, Bruschetta Bar Salad Selected: Mixed Field Greens w Pears, Goat Cheese, Pear Infused Vinaigrette. *Alts: Candied Walnuts & Second Balsamic Dressing to offer Dinner Selections: 1. Filet w Red Wine Demi Sauce, Garlic Mashed Potatoes, & Asparagus 2. Garlic & Herb Cheese Stuffed Chicken, Vodka Sauce w Bowtie Noodles, & Grilled Veggies 3. Butternut Squash Ravioli w Sage Brown Butter Sauce, Grilled Veggies *Kid's Meals & Vegan Meal offered otherwise at no upcharge Dessert Selections: 1. Mini Cookie Tray- Chocolate Chip, Oatmeal Raisin, Sugar, M&M, Double Chocolate, Peanut Butter 2. Assorted Chocolate Truffles- Oreo, Buckeye, Aztec

    One of the best decisions I have ever made was booking Froggy's to cater our wedding. Thierry was…read morethe absolute BEST. He was so experienced and professional. From the start he was very accommodating and he gave wonderful recommendations and advice (since we had no idea what we were doing :P). I am not a very organized and I'm a procrastinator, but Thierry always emailed me when necessary and made sure I was on track with everything (which was not even his job!!!)--it was so sweet and very much appreciated. Even before the wedding, he did a walk through with me at our venue and helped me decide where everything would go (bars, tables, etc) and talked with our reception venue to talk about logistics. On the wedding day, I had no idea that our reception venue was not providing napkins (they only provided the tablecloths) and before I had a chance to freak out because Thierry told me we had no napkins, he had already ordered them and we're having them delivered over as we were speaking. During the reception, the food came out in a timely manner, the wait staff and bartenders were amazing and the food was phenomenal!! I got so many compliments about the food (many people raved that it was the best wedding food they ever had)!! But the greatest was the cake!!!! It is the best cake I have ever tasted. My aunt who usually does not like dessert ate two whole slices of cake! Not only was the food and service amazing, but they are wonderful people who really care about you. Even our other vendors told us that they were by far the best people they have ever worked with--not only did the froggy's staff take care of the guests and the bride & groom, but they took care of all the other vendors as well. THEY ARE AMAZING--you will regret not choosing them as your wedding or special event caterers! SO BOOK AWAY! I added some pictures to the review so you can see for yourself!! The food tasted even better than it looked!! Unfortunately, the photographers didn't get a chance to take pictures of the amazing hor dourves!!
